Why Medium Format Cameras Demand Specialized Tripod Support

Medium format systems present unique challenges that go far beyond simple weight considerations. The combination of larger mirrors, bigger sensors, and higher resolution creates a perfect storm of stability requirements that most standard tripods simply cannot handle effectively.

The Weight Factor: Understanding Payload Requirements

A typical medium format camera body with a digital back and professional lens can easily exceed 3-4 kilograms (6.6-8.8 pounds), with some technical camera setups pushing past 5 kilograms. This isn’t just about supporting static weight—it’s about maintaining absolute rigidity during mirror actuation, shutter curtain movement, and in windy conditions. The tripod must act as a virtual extension of your hands, eliminating any micro-movements that would be invisible with smaller formats but become glaringly obvious when magnified on a 100MP sensor.

Mirror Slap and Vibration Challenges

The larger mirror mechanism in medium format SLR-style cameras generates significantly more vibration than their 35mm counterparts. This “mirror slap” can resonate through an inadequate tripod for several seconds, turning what should be a crisp 1/125th second exposure into a soft, disappointing result. Even mirrorless medium format cameras aren’t immune—their larger mechanical shutters and sensor assemblies create their own vibration signatures that demand exceptional damping characteristics from your support system.

Load Capacity: The Non-Negotiable Starting Point

Manufacturers’ load capacity ratings are perhaps the most misunderstood specification in tripod marketing. Understanding what these numbers actually mean—and more importantly, what they don’t mean—forms the foundation of making an informed purchase decision.

The 2x Rule for Medium Format Safety Margins

Industry veterans apply a simple but crucial rule: your tripod’s rated load capacity should be at least double your heaviest camera-lens combination. If your setup weighs 4kg, you need a tripod rated for 8kg or more. This isn’t paranoia—it’s physics. Load ratings typically represent the absolute maximum weight before structural failure, not the optimal weight for vibration-free performance. That 2x buffer ensures the tripod operates in its stability sweet spot, where leg angles and material tension provide maximum rigidity rather than flexing under strain.

Dynamic vs Static Load: What Manufacturers Don’t Tell You

Tripod ratings almost always reference static load—weight sitting stationary on the head. But photography involves dynamic forces: pressing the shutter button, adjusting focus, wind gusts, even your hand resting on the camera. Dynamic loads can momentarily spike to 1.5-2x the static weight, pushing marginal tripods into instability territory. Heavy-duty tripods designed for medium format work incorporate design elements like reinforced leg joints and wider base spreads specifically to handle these dynamic forces without transmitting vibration to the camera.

Material Science: Carbon Fiber vs Aluminum for Heavy Duty Use

The carbon fiber versus aluminum debate extends far beyond weight savings. Each material exhibits distinct vibration transmission characteristics, temperature behavior, and failure modes that directly impact medium format image quality.

Vibration Damping Characteristics

Carbon fiber excels at high-frequency vibration damping—the quick, sharp vibrations from mirror slap and shutter shock. Its layered construction dissipates energy laterally through the tube walls rather than transmitting it vertically toward the camera. Aluminum, being more homogeneous, tends to ring like a tuning fork, sustaining vibrations longer. However, high-end aluminum tripods with engineered internal damping mechanisms can rival entry-level carbon fiber for vibration control, often at lower cost.

Weight-to-Strength Ratios in Real-World Scenarios

While carbon fiber offers superior strength-to-weight ratios, this advantage diminishes in heavy-duty applications where absolute rigidity trumps portability. The thickest carbon fiber tubes (32mm+) needed for medium format stability approach the weight of comparable aluminum legs while maintaining better vibration characteristics. The real differentiator becomes construction quality—how layers are bonded, wall thickness consistency, and joint engineering matter more than the material itself.

Temperature and Environmental Considerations

Aluminum becomes painfully cold in sub-zero temperatures and can cause condensation issues when moving between environments. Carbon fiber’s lower thermal conductivity makes it more comfortable to handle in extreme cold and less prone to thermal shock. However, carbon fiber can become brittle after prolonged UV exposure, a factor often overlooked by landscape photographers working at high altitudes. Quality heavy-duty tripods address these issues through UV-resistant resins and anodized aluminum components designed for thermal cycling.

Tripod Geometry and Stability Engineering

The mathematical relationship between leg angle, center of gravity, and base dimensions determines real-world stability more than any other design factor. Understanding these principles helps you recognize genuinely stable designs versus marketing claims.

Leg Angle Adjustments and Stability Trade-offs

Most professional tripods offer multiple leg angle positions—typically 25°, 55°, and 80° from vertical. Wider angles dramatically increase stability by lowering the camera’s center of gravity and widening the support base. For medium format work, the ability to lock legs at the widest angle without flexing is crucial. Some designs sacrifice this capability for compactness, using narrower minimum angles that look stable but fail under real-world loads. Test this yourself: extend the legs to their widest setting and apply gentle downward pressure—any wiggle indicates inadequate engineering for heavy payloads.

Center Column: Asset or Liability?

The center column represents the ultimate compromise in tripod design. While convenient for height adjustment, it functionally transforms your stable three-legged platform into a monopod perched atop the apex. For medium format cameras, a center column should be considered an emergency height booster, not a primary working position. The most stable heavy-duty tripods feature either no center column or a removable one, allowing direct mounting of the head to the apex for maximum rigidity. If you must have a column, look for those with diameters exceeding 40mm and robust locking mechanisms that eliminate any play.

The Importance of a Low Center of Gravity

Professional tripod designs position the head mounting plate as close to the apex as possible, minimizing the distance between the camera’s center of gravity and the support triangle. Some designs elevate this plate for “convenience,” creating a lever arm that multiplies any instability. For medium format systems, look for tripods where the head sits directly on the apex casting, with the option to mount directly to the legs when the column is removed.

Head Matters: Matching Your Support System to Your Camera

The tripod head is where camera meets support, and this interface demands the same engineering rigor as the legs themselves. An inadequate head on premium legs is like mounting racing tires on a economy car—the weakest link determines overall performance.

Ball Heads vs Geared Heads for Precision Work

Ball heads offer speed and flexibility but require robust locking mechanisms to hold medium format weights securely. Look for those with oversized balls (60mm+) and tension control that allows micro-adjustments without sudden releases. Geared heads provide unparalleled precision for architectural and studio work, using worm gears to make minute adjustments without unlocking the camera. The trade-off is weight and speed—geared heads can add 1-2kg to your kit but eliminate the “sag” that even premium ball heads exhibit under heavy loads.

Panoramic Considerations for Medium Format Sensors

Medium format’s wider field of view and higher resolution demand precise panoramic rotation. Standard heads often exhibit base wobble that goes unnoticed with smaller formats but creates stitching nightmares with medium format images. Look for heads with independent panning locks and calibrated degree markings. The base should rotate on a separate bearing from the ball or gear mechanism, ensuring smooth, consistent movement without affecting the primary lock.

Height Requirements: Working Comfortably Without Compromise

The tallest tripod isn’t always the best choice, but working height significantly impacts both comfort and stability. The key is finding the sweet spot for your shooting style without resorting to the center column.

Eye-Level Shooting and the No-Column Advantage

For a 6-foot photographer, eye level sits around 175cm. Achieving this height without extending a center column requires tripod legs approaching 150cm before head mounting. This is why many heavy-duty tripods for medium format prioritize leg length over compactness. The ability to work at eye level without compromising stability is worth the extra packed length. Some designs achieve this through four-section legs that maintain rigidity better than five-section alternatives, though setup takes slightly longer.

Ground-Level Capabilities for Unique Perspectives

The same tripod that reaches eye level should also position your medium format camera inches from the ground for macro and landscape work. This requires legs that can splay completely flat and a removable or reversible center column. Look for designs where the head can be mounted directly to the apex casting even when legs are fully spread, maintaining stability at minimum height. The best designs allow ground-level shooting without inverting the column, which places the camera in a precarious, vibration-prone position.

Leg Lock Mechanisms: Speed, Security, and Maintenance

How legs lock—and stay locked—directly impacts both convenience and safety. The debate between twist locks and lever locks involves more than personal preference when supporting $20,000+ of medium format equipment.

Twist Locks vs Lever Locks in Cold Weather

Twist locks offer fewer failure points and better sealing against dust and moisture but can become difficult to operate with cold hands or gloves. High-quality twist locks use O-ring seals and require minimal rotation—typically 1/4 to 1/2 turn—for full release and lock. Lever locks provide instant operation but introduce complexity: more moving parts, potential for accidental release, and difficulty in achieving consistent tension across all locks. For medium format work, the reliability of well-designed twist locks often outweighs the convenience of levers, especially for field photographers working in harsh conditions.

Sealing and Dust Resistance for Field Work

Medium format photographers often work in environments where dust and moisture are constant companions. Leg locks should incorporate internal seals that prevent grit from entering the leg tubes, where it acts like sandpaper on the precision-fit components. Look for designs that allow easy cleaning—removable leg shims and accessible lock mechanisms that can be serviced without specialized tools. Some premium designs feature fully sealed leg tubes that can be rinsed clean after shooting in salt spray or desert conditions.

Feet and Anchoring Systems: The Foundation of Stability

The interface between tripod and ground is often overlooked until you encounter your first unstable surface. Professional tripods treat feet as mission-critical components rather than afterthoughts.

Interchangeable Foot Systems Explained

Heavy-duty tripods should offer tool-free foot changes between rubber and spiked options. The attachment mechanism must be absolutely secure—any play here translates directly to camera movement. Look for feet that thread into metal inserts within the leg tubes, not plastic sockets that crack under torque. The best designs use a standardized thread size across the industry, allowing third-party foot accessories and replacements years down the line.

Spiked vs Rubber: Terrain-Specific Choices

Rubber feet excel on hard surfaces by providing grip and vibration isolation through their compliant material. However, on soft ground, they can sink unevenly or slip on wet grass. Spiked feet penetrate soft surfaces for absolute stability but transmit ground vibrations more readily and can damage indoor flooring. For medium format work, consider tripods that include both options plus specialty feet like snowshoes for sand or snow, and clawed feet for rocky terrain. The ability to adapt your anchoring system to the environment is crucial for maintaining the stability your high-resolution sensor demands.

Portability vs Stability: The Eternal Compromise

Every photographer dreams of a tripod that’s both featherlight and rock-solid. The reality is that medium format photography demands prioritizing stability, but intelligent design can minimize the portability penalty.

Folded Length and Travel Realities

Heavy-duty tripods for medium format typically fold to 60-75cm, making them challenging carry-on items. Some designs reverse-fold legs around the head, reducing packed length by 15-20cm but potentially compromising leg angle mechanisms. Consider your primary use case: studio photographers can prioritize maximum stability with longer folded lengths, while location photographers might accept slightly reduced rigidity for packability. The sweet spot often lies in three-section legs, which are more stable than four-section designs but pack longer.

Carrying Solutions for Heavy Duty Systems

A 3kg tripod with a 1kg head represents a significant load, especially when hiking to remote locations. Look for tripods with ergonomic carry bags that distribute weight across your shoulders rather than concentrating it on a single strap. Some designs incorporate backpack attachment points or include padded leg wraps for comfortable shoulder carrying. The bag itself should protect the tripod without adding excessive weight—think durable, water-resistant fabric with reinforced corners rather than heavy padding.

Special Features Worth the Investment

Beyond basic stability, certain features address specific medium format shooting scenarios. These additions can transform a good tripod into an indispensable creative tool.

Integrated Leveling Bases for Architectural Photography

For architectural and landscape work, a leveling base allows precise camera leveling without adjusting leg lengths—a process that’s time-consuming and often imprecise. Integrated leveling bases sit between the apex and head, providing up to 15° of adjustment via a separate knob. This feature proves invaluable when shooting stitched panoramas or perspective-corrected images where perfect level is non-negotiable. The mechanism must be robust enough to lock absolutely firm under medium format loads.

Vibration Reduction Accessories

Some heavy-duty systems offer accessories like weight hooks, sandbags, or magnetic damping plates that attach to the apex or center column. These allow you to add mass to the tripod system, lowering the center of gravity and changing the resonant frequency to dampen wind-induced vibrations. For long exposures in breezy conditions, hanging your camera bag from a sturdy hook can make the difference between a keeper and a blurred failure. Ensure any weight hook is rated for at least 10kg and attaches securely to the tripod’s main structure, not a flimsy column extension.

Maintenance and Longevity: Protecting Your Investment

A professional-grade tripod should last decades, not years. Proper maintenance ensures consistent performance and protects the significant investment you’ve made in your support system.

Regular cleaning of leg locks prevents abrasive dust from scoring precision surfaces. After saltwater or dusty shoots, extend all leg sections and rinse with fresh water, then dry thoroughly before storage. Lubricate O-rings annually with silicone grease to maintain sealing performance. Check leg tension periodically—most quality tripods allow you to adjust the friction of leg angle stops and lock mechanisms using hex keys. Store your tripod uncompressed with legs fully extended to prevent creep in the lock mechanisms. For carbon fiber legs, inspect for impact damage or delamination, particularly after drops or impacts. Even minor cracks can compromise vibration damping and load capacity.

Budget Considerations: Understanding the Cost-to-Value Ratio

Heavy-duty tripods for medium format represent a significant expenditure, with professional-grade systems ranging from several hundred to over a thousand dollars. Understanding where that money goes helps justify the investment.

The cost reflects material quality, manufacturing tolerances, and engineering complexity. Premium carbon fiber layups use higher-modulus fibers and more precise orientation, increasing material costs by 3-4x over consumer-grade options. Machined aluminum castings for the apex and leg joints require expensive CNC work but provide the absolute rigidity medium format demands. Bearings in panning bases, sealing systems, and corrosion-resistant hardware all add cost but deliver reliability in field conditions. Consider this: a $800 tripod that lasts 15 years costs $53 annually—far less than replacing a $300 tripod every three years when it fails to support your evolving medium format system.

Frequently Asked Questions

What minimum load capacity should I look for with a 4kg medium format setup?

Aim for a rated capacity of at least 8-10kg to maintain the 2x safety margin. Remember that dynamic loads from wind or handling can momentarily exceed static weight, and the rating represents maximum before failure, not optimal performance.

Can I use my existing 35mm tripod for medium format in a pinch?

For short lenses and calm conditions, possibly. But longer focal lengths, macro work, or any situation requiring critical sharpness will reveal inadequacies. The vibration damping and rigidity requirements are fundamentally different—what’s acceptable for 24MP 35mm format will disappoint at 100MP medium format.

How much should I expect to spend on a professional heavy-duty tripod system?

Plan for $600-$1200 for legs alone, plus $300-$800 for a suitable head. This represents the entry point for systems engineered specifically for medium format loads. Budget options claiming similar specs typically compromise on material quality, joint tolerances, or long-term reliability.

Is a center column ever acceptable for medium format work?

Only as an occasional height booster, never as your primary working height. If you must use one, ensure it exceeds 40mm diameter, locks with multiple friction points, and can be removed for low-angle work. Better yet, choose a tripod where you can mount the head directly to the apex.

What’s the maximum safe height without using a center column?

For most photographers, 150-160cm of leg extension provides eye-level shooting when paired with a head and camera. Taller photographers may need 170cm+ leg sets. Remember that stability decreases with height, so extend the thickest leg sections fully before using thinner upper sections.

How do I test a tripod’s stability before purchasing?

Fully extend the legs at their widest angle, mount your heaviest lens, and gently tap the camera. Watch the viewfinder image—settling within 1-2 seconds indicates good damping. Any continued oscillation or visible flexing in the legs suggests inadequate rigidity for medium format work.

Are four-section legs less stable than three-section designs?

Generally yes, though the difference is less pronounced in premium designs. Each joint introduces potential flex and vibration transmission points. Three-section legs have fewer joints and wider tube diameters for a given collapsed length, making them inherently more rigid—a worthwhile trade-off for studio work where packed size matters less.

What’s the best head type for landscape versus studio medium format work?

For landscape, a robust ball head with independent panning lock offers speed and flexibility. For studio and architectural work, a geared head provides the precision needed for technical camera movements and perspective control. Some photographers own both, swapping heads based on the assignment.

How often should I service my heavy-duty tripod?

Professional photographers service their primary tripods annually, while enthusiast users can typically wait 2-3 years. Signs you need immediate service include sticky leg locks, visible leg flex, or any play in the apex casting. Regular cleaning after harsh shoots extends service intervals significantly.

Can tripod stability be improved with aftermarket modifications?

Yes, but carefully. Adding weight via a hook is safe and effective. Replacing rubber feet with spiked ones for specific terrain helps. However, avoid aftermarket leg wraps or accessories that attach to leg tubes—they can interfere with lock mechanisms and potentially create stress points. Stick to manufacturer-approved accessories.
